Tony wrote:
I'd love software that wipes clean the entire portion of the
hard drive that doesn't have something I still want on it.

Here is a PDF that explains how to use Apple's Disk Utility (OSX) or Drive Setup (OS 9)
<technology.pitt.edu/documentation/mac_disk_erase.pdf>

Eraser Pro (shareware) here <http://users.libero.it/yellowsoft/theeraser.html>

Shredit (commercial program) here <http://www.mireth.com/shredit.html>

A large hammer works well too.
